Early Life

Eddy Lover, born on March 16, 1985 in Panama City, Panama, showed a passion for music from a young age. At just 12 years old, he began singing and exploring his musical talents. His love for reggae music was evident early on, and he quickly found his voice in the genre.

Rise to Fame

Eddy Lover's career took off in the early 2000s when he recorded his first song, "Lloro." His soulful vocals and heartfelt lyrics caught the attention of music fans and industry professionals alike. In 2008, he released "Luna," the lead single off his debut album, Perdóname. The song quickly climbed the charts, reaching #2 on the US Billboard Latin Tropical Airplay charts, solidifying Eddy Lover's status as a rising star in the reggae music scene.

Collaborations and Achievements

One of Eddy Lover's most notable collaborations was with the reggae duo La Factoria on the song "Perdóname." The track received worldwide acclaim and further established Eddy Lover as a talented singer and songwriter. Throughout his career, he continued to release hit songs and albums, with notable tracks like "Rueda Rueda" and "No Debiste Volver."
